DESIGN/PURPOSE
When engine oil pressure is low, the engine oil pressure warning informs the driver of low oil pressure to prevent damage to the engine.

SIGNAL PATH
ECM calculates an engine oil pressure according to a signal transmitted from the engine oil pressure sensor. After engine running when the engine oil pressure is low and at least 5 seconds, ECM transmits the engine oil pressure warning signal to combination meter via CAN communication. Then the engine oil pressure warning displays.
LIGHTING CONDITION
When all of the following conditions for at least 5 seconds are satisfied:
Ignition switch: ON
Engine oil pressure is less than specified value.
Engine speed is more than 500 rpm.
SHUTOFF CONDITION
When any of the following conditions is satisfied:
Ignition switch: OFF
Engine oil pressure is the specified value or more.
Engine speed is less than 500 rpm.
